Old Garmentmaker is an NPC on Amphoreus, located in Aedes Elysiae. It serves as the location's hub for the Creation Nymph system.
Profile
Old Garmentmaker is one of Aglaea's Garmentmakers, set up in the area to help the Trailblazer in collecting the Creation Nymphs.
